Common Causes of Accidents in Madelia
Identifying common causes of accidents in Madelia can provide valuable insights into the factors contributing to traffic incidents in the area. By analyzing accident data from the Madelia Police Department, it is possible to identify recurring patterns and potential areas for improvement in traffic safety.
One common cause of accidents in Madelia is distracted driving, which includes activities such as using cell phones, eating, or adjusting the radio while driving.
Another prevalent cause is speeding, where drivers exceed the posted speed limits.
Additionally, impaired driving, such as dri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s, contributes significantly to accidents in Madelia.
Poor road conditions, such as slippery surfaces or inadequate signage, can also play a role.
Understanding these common causes of accidents can help inform targeted interventions and policies aimed at reducing traffic incidents in Madelia.
Strategies for Accident Prevention in Madelia
Implementing effective strategies for accident prevention in Madelia requires a comprehensive approach that addresses factors such as distracted driving, speeding, impaired driving, and poor road conditions.
Distracted driving, characterized by activities like texting or talking on the phone while driving, has become a major concern in recent years. To combat this issue, educational campaigns and stricter enforcement of laws against cellphone use while driving can be implemented.
Speeding is another significant factor contributing to accidents. It is essential to enforce speed limits and use traffic calming measures, such as speed bumps or roundabouts, in high-risk areas.
Additionally, impaired driving, primarily caused by alcohol or drug use, can be mitigated through increased law enforcement efforts, public awareness campaigns, and stricter penalties.
Lastly, addressing poor road conditions, such as potholes or inadequate signage, can be achieved through regular maintenance and improvements to the infrastructure.
